1, the polynomial about x, the highest degree is odd.
When x →∞, y →∞, so there is at least one real number root.
2. The principle of root-piercing method. The highest odd degree has at least one real root.
3. The so-called odd degree means that the degree of the x highest term of an equation or function is odd. The so-called even degree means that the degree of the x highest term of an equation or function is even.
The highest number of unknowns of a unary algebraic expression function or equation is the number of functions or equations, which is odd, that is, odd; Even numbers are even numbers. Odd equations have at least 1 real roots, and even equations may have no real roots.

The symbol of infinity is that its Unicode is u+221e "∞" infinity, which is expressed as \ infinity in LaTeX.
1655 john wallis first used infinite symbols. After they are used, they are also used in fields other than mathematics, such as modern mysticism and semiotics.

Irregular fragment shape
The fractal structure can be enlarged repeatedly, and the fractal can be infinitely enlarged, but it will not become smooth and still maintain its original structure. The perimeter of fractal is infinite, some areas are infinite, but some areas are finite. For example, the Koch curve is an example of infinite perimeter and limited area.
